SCENE TWO
LIGHTS BARELY UP ON THE OCEAN FLOOR, A FEW DAYS AFTER SCENE ONE. THE STAGE IS EMPTY, BUT LIT BLUE TO GIVE THE IMPRESSION OF A COLD OCEAN. THE SCENE COULD BE PLAYED IN FRONT OF THE CURTAIN WHILE SET CHANGE HAPPENS. FROM OFFSTAGE, WE HEAR JOHN AND KOVACS.
KOVACS
(off stage)
No! I told you, I don’t care.
JOHN
(off stage)
Oh come on! What is one little guess going to do?
KOVACS AND JOHN ENTER.
KOVACS
One little guess? You’ve wanted to play 20 questions since we left! What happened to “wanting this time to think?”
JOHN
We got plenty of time out here to think. At least months,–
KOVACS
(aside)
Don’t remind me.
JOHN
–so we might as well have at least some fun. Now guess!
KOVACS
Fine. Is it a fish?
JOHN
No.
KOVACS
Is it water?
JOHN
Yea!
KOVACS
Good. Then we’re done. Can I get back to figuring out this death thing now?
KOVACS WALKS OFF IN A HUFF, LOOKING AT HIS PHOTO AS HE DOES SO. JOHN NOTICES THIS AND WATCHES HIM FOR A MOMENT BEFORE LEAVING TO CATCH UP.
JOHN
Hey! Wait up!
END SCENE
